Abstract

This article presents a historical panorama of dialectology and geolinguistics in Brazil and contains five sections: (1) an introduction offering an overview of the methods used in dialectology, such as vocabularies, monographs, and atlases; (2) the phases of the history of dialectology in Brazil, which initiated in 1826 and developed for almost two centuries culminating in the publication of the Atlas Linguístico do Brasil in 2014; (3) the regional history of geolinguistics in Brazil and its specific centers of study; (4) a discussion of some phonetic and lexical aspects registered in the Atlas linguístico do Brasil, comparing them to the proposal of the classical dialectical division by Nascentes (1953) and, finally, (5) some concluding remarks.
